解决ComfyUI-Florence2模型加载难题:从消失节点到顺畅运行的完整指南
【免费下载链接】ComfyUI-Florence2Inference Microsoft Florence2 VLM项目地址: https://gitcode.com/gh_mirrors/co/ComfyUI-Florence2
认识Florence2模型加载问题
你是否遇到过这样的情况:在ComfyUI中兴冲冲地想要使用Florence2模型,却发现模型加载节点神秘消失,控制台还弹出"目录不存在"的错误提示?别担心,这是ComfyUI-Florence2用户最常见的技术挑战之一,而解决方法比你想象的要简单得多。
问题背后的技术真相
让我们用一个生活化的比喻来理解这个问题:想象你去一家新餐厅就餐,服务员却告诉你厨房找不到食材储藏室——ComfyUI就像这家餐厅,而Florence2ModelLoader节点就是那位服务员,ComfyUI/models/LLM/目录则是食材储藏室。当储藏室(目录)不存在时,服务员(节点)自然无法正常工作。
在项目的nodes.py文件中,代码默认会到ComfyUI/models/LLM/目录下寻找模型文件。当这个特定目录不存在时,系统就会出现节点无法初始化的情况。
解决方案:两种途径任你选
方案一:手动创建目录结构(适合喜欢亲自动手的你)
如果你是那种喜欢亲手搭建东西的技术爱好者,手动创建目录会让你更有掌控感:
- 找到你的ComfyUI安装文件夹,这就像找到餐厅的后台入口
- 进入
models子文件夹,这里是所有模型的"仓库区" - 在
models文件夹中创建一个名为LLM的新文件夹,这就是我们为Florence2准备的专属"储藏室"
完成后,你的目录结构应该像这样:
ComfyUI/ └── models/ └── LLM/方案二:使用自动下载节点(适合追求便捷的你)
项目开发者早就想到了这个问题,贴心地提供了DownloadAndLoadFlorence2Model节点,它就像一位全能管家,能自动完成所有设置工作:
- 在ComfyUI界面中找到这个特殊节点,它通常在"Florence2"分类下
- 选择你需要的模型版本(如base或large版)
- 运行节点,系统会自动创建所需目录、下载模型并完成配置
图:Florence2模型加载节点设置流程示意图
验证解决方案是否成功
完成上述步骤后,让我们检查一下问题是否真的解决了:
- 重新启动ComfyUI,给系统一个"重新认识"新设置的机会
- 查看节点列表,
Florence2ModelLoader节点应该已经重新出现 - 检查控制台输出,之前的"目录不存在"错误应该消失了
- 尝试加载一个Florence2模型,验证是否能正常工作
新手常见误区警示
⚠️路径混淆:不要将LLM目录创建在ComfyUI-Florence2插件目录下,而是要放在主程序的models目录中 ⚠️权限问题:确保ComfyUI有对models目录的写入权限,否则自动下载功能会失败 ⚠️版本选择:新手建议从base版本开始使用,大型模型需要更多系统资源
问题预防清单
为了避免未来再次遇到类似问题,建议你:
✅ 首次使用时优先选择DownloadAndLoadFlorence2Model节点 ✅ 了解ComfyUI的标准模型存放位置 ✅ 定期检查模型目录结构是否完整 ✅ 确保系统有足够的存储空间安装模型
模型选择指南
Florence2提供了多个版本,就像不同大小的工具箱,各有适用场景:
📦microsoft/Florence-2-base:轻量级版本,适合入门学习和资源有限的设备 📦microsoft/Florence-2-large:功能更强大的版本,适合专业应用和复杂任务 📦优化版本:社区贡献的各种优化版本,针对特定场景进行了性能调整
进阶应用场景
解决了基础加载问题后,你可以探索这些高级应用:
- 多模型协作:将Florence2与其他视觉模型结合使用,创建更复杂的工作流
- 批量处理:利用Florence2的批量处理能力,一次性分析多张图片
- 自定义训练:在基础模型上进行微调,适应特定领域的需求
希望这篇指南能帮助你顺利解决Florence2模型的加载问题。记住,技术难题就像拼图游戏,只要找到正确的那块(在这里就是正确的目录结构),一切都会变得清晰起来。现在,尽情享受Florence2带来的强大视觉AI能力吧!
【免费下载链接】ComfyUI-Florence2Inference Microsoft Florence2 VLM项目地址: https://gitcode.com/gh_mirrors/co/ComfyUI-Florence2
创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考